Job Summary

Under indirect supervision, perform duties in Materials Management Facilities including, but not limited to, shipping, receiving, storing, issuing and inventory of parts, materials and equipment.  Record all transactions.  Load, unload and transport parts, materials and equipment and perform other duties as assigned.

  • The duties of this classification are set forth in the job specification for Materials Specialist.

  • Employees in this classification will be assigned to perform work and participate in training resulting in qualifications for promotion to Materials Specialist at the end of two years.
